Mr. Indra Kumar Singh 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E PRAKASH CHANDRA JAISWAL ORAL ORDER 11-01-2019 Heard learned counsel for the petitioners and learned APP for the State.
The petitioners seek bail in connection with Ismailpur P.S. Case no. 35 of 2018 registered under Sections 147, 148, 149, 341, 323, 504, 506 and 307 of the Indian Penal Code and Section 27 of the Arms Act.
Accused Subodh Mandal is said to have resorted firing by means of three nut on the informant inflicting injury on his back while petitioner Sukho Mandal @ Sukhi Mandal and Girdhari Mandal indiscriminately fired during the course of retreat, but no one has sustained injury in the said fire over the row of installation of hut.
It is submitted by learned counsel for the petitioners
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.78338 of 2018(2) dt.11-01-2019 2/2 that the petitioners are quite innocent and have been falsely implicated in this case. Petitioners are not assailant. There is land dispute between the parties. The indiscriminate firing allegedly made by the petitioner had not hit anyone. The allegation levelled against the petitioners is not specific rather general and omnibus. The petitioners have no criminal antecedent. Petitioner no. 1 has been languishing in custody since 04.10.2018 while Petitioner no. 2 since 16.09.2018. In the facts and circumstances of the case, the above named petitioners are directed to be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s. 10,000/- (Ten th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the learned Sub-Divisional Judicial Magistrate, Naugachia, Bhagalpur in connection with Ismailpur P.S. Case no. 35 of 2018.
